Aug 20th User Group Meeting
Our August user group meeting is coming up. This meeting will have a combination of 3 key topics: Marketing, Sales, and Adv Admin/Baby Dev.
The Marketing track, Knowing when to pull the trigger, will focus around lead generation and qualification. We have Joshua Tillman from Refractive dialer bring in a customer to present how they utilize the tool to bring in more leads and their qualification process.
The Sales will be on how to defog that crystal ball, pipeline/forecast management. Michael Bonner from Pipeline Manager will be brining a customer to explain how they utilize their tool to help gain insight and manage the pipeline.
The Adv Admin/Baby Dev will focus on getting started with Eclipse and how set up your first site. Micaiah Filkins from Force by Design will be showing us the basics of Eclipse and how to start publishing some of your data in Salesforce to the outside world.

Opportunity Management, Forecasting only with Salesforce.com
Opportunity Forecasting Webinar - Click here to register
The third Thursday is upon us which means we get to meet for another webinar. We have Angela Pellegrino, Salesforce Administrator, at LinkedIn to talk to us about how they've been doing forecasting all nativly within Salesforce. They don't use the Salesforce Forecast module and she'll walk you through what customizations she did to their opportunities to make it work for them: new picklists, formula fields and some validation rules.
Then I'll show you the "One" report our COO looks at to run his forecast. Incidentally it stopped him from modify the entire renewal ordering process with one formula field and this report. If we have time I'll show you how we automated our 'customer base'. Can you say you know exactly how many new customers you added this quarter? How about Lost? What do you consider a customer, anyone that has purchased or one that is currently under support?
